BORDER TENSIONS

Israel claims to have shot down another drone "linked to Hezbollah"

BEIRUT — The Israeli army intercepted and shot down a drone Monday that was launched from Lebanon across the southern border and is allegedly “linked to Hezbollah,” an Israeli army spokesperson said in a tweet.

Here’s what we know:

   • A Hezbollah spokesperson told L’Orient Today that Hezbollah has no information about the incident.

   • The incident comes at a time when the dispute over the delineation of the maritime border between Lebanon and Israel is in full swing, especially after Hezbollah sent three unarmed drones towards the offshore Karish gas field early July.

   • Hezbollah chief Hassan Nasrallah said in a televised speech Wednesday on the anniversary of the 2006 July War with Israel that his party is “militarily and financially capable of preventing [Israel] from extracting [gas] from the disputed Karish field and all [Israel’s] measures will not be capable of protecting its floating platform.”

   • On June 5, Israel deployed a floating production, storage and offloading vessel to the disputed Karish offshore gas field, causing tensions with the Lebanese side.

   • “Our air surveillance units followed the drone throughout its flight,” the Israeli army spokesperson said, adding that Israel will continue to work to “prevent any violations of the Israeli state’s sovereignty.”

   • Meanwhile, Hezbollah’s parliamentary bloc leader MP Mohammad Raad said Saturday that Hezbollah “does not want a war, but [the party] is ready and on alert.”
